The Drought Coordination Technical Committee of the Metropolitan Washington Council of Governments, which consists of 24 local governments in the region, announced this drought watch on Monday and encouraged residents to adopt water-saving measures during this period. Clark Mercer, executive director of the Metropolitan Washington Council of Governments, emphasized the importance of using water wisely as officials continue to monitor drought conditions closely. Residents are advised to take shorter showers (under five minutes), use brooms instead of hoses for cleaning sidewalks, be mindful when watering plants or lawns, turn off taps while brushing teeth, and wash full loads when doing laundry or dishes among other conservation tips. The committee noted that while water flow in the Potomac River is currently low, prior planning has equipped the region to handle potential drought situations effectively. Michael Nardolilli from the Interstate Commission on the Potomac River Basin stated that thanks to years of preparation, their water supply infrastructure is well-prepared for droughts; however, it remains crucial for everyone to conserve this vital resource. Local officials also highlighted that although there is enough water supply at present, if conditions worsen and a drought warning is issued later on, mandatory restrictions may be enforced for water conservation.
